The Science Behind Vapes

To understand why smoke is still coming out of your empty vape, you first need to understand how vapes work. Vapes use a heating element, typically a coil, to heat up a liquid, called e-liquid or vape juice, which then turns into vapor that you inhale.

The Role of E-Liquid

Even when your vape cartridge is empty, there may still be some e-liquid left in the coil. This e-liquid can continue to heat up and turn into vapor, even if there’s not enough of it to produce a full hit.

But be warned, hitting an empty vape can be harmful to your health. When there’s no e-liquid left, the coil can start to burn, producing harmful chemicals that you definitely don’t want to inhale.

So, if you notice that your vape cartridge is empty but there’s still smoke coming out, it’s time to replace the cartridge. Don’t risk your health by hitting an empty vape.

Smoke or Vapor? The Great Debate

Ah, the age-old question that has plagued vapers since the beginning of time (or at least since the invention of the e-cigarette): is it smoke or vapor that comes out of your vape?

The answer, my friend, is vapor. That’s right, despite what your friends, family, and coworkers may say, you are not smoking when you vape. You are inhaling vapor.

But why does this matter? Well, for starters, smoking and vaping are two very different things. Smoking involves the combustion of tobacco, which produces smoke that contains a whole host of harmful chemicals. Vaping, on the other hand, involves heating up a liquid (usually containing nicotine) until it turns into a vapor that you can inhale.

This distinction is important because it means that vaping is generally considered to be less harmful than smoking. While vaping is not completely risk-free, it is widely believed to be a safer alternative to smoking.

So, the next time someone asks you if you’re smoking that thing, you can confidently correct them and say, “Actually, it’s vapor, thank you very much.”

But wait, you might be thinking, if it’s vapor and not smoke, why does it sometimes look like smoke? Well, that’s because vapor and smoke can look pretty similar, especially in certain lighting conditions. However, there are a few key differences between the two:

Smoke Vapor
Produced by combustion Produced by heating up a liquid
Contains harmful chemicals Contains fewer harmful chemicals
Smells like smoke Can have various flavors
Lingers in the air Disperses quickly

So, there you have it. The great debate has been settled (at least for now). Vaping produces vapor, not smoke. And while the two may look similar, they are fundamentally different. The Ghostly Phenomenon: Can Empty Vapes Produce Smoke?

So, you’re sitting there with your vape in hand, taking a puff, and suddenly you notice something strange. Smoke is still coming out of your vape even though the cartridge is empty. How is this possible? Are you experiencing some sort of ghostly phenomenon?

Well, fear not, my friend. This is actually a common occurrence in the world of vaping. When your vape cartridge is empty, it doesn’t mean that there is absolutely no oil left in it. There may still be a small amount of oil left on the wick or the coil. When you heat up the coil, this oil can still produce vapor, which can look like smoke.

However, it’s important to note that vaping an empty cartridge is not recommended. When you vape an empty cartridge, you risk damaging your coil and your device. It’s best to replace the cartridge as soon as you notice that it’s running low on oil.

Another reason why smoke may still be coming out of your vape is that your cartridge may not actually be empty. Sometimes, the oil can get stuck in the corners or the edges of the cartridge, making it difficult to see how much oil is actually left.

Vape Maintenance: Keeping Your Vape Smoke-Free

One of the most important things you can do to keep your vape smoke-free is to clean it regularly. This means taking apart your vape and cleaning each piece individually. Use warm water and a few drops of dish soap to clean the tank, coil, and mouthpiece. Don’t forget to dry everything thoroughly before reassembling your vape.

Another way to keep your vape smoke-free is to replace your coil regularly. Over time, the coil can become clogged with residue from the e-juice, which can affect the flavor and produce less vapor. Replace your coil every two weeks or whenever you switch to a new e-juice flavor.

It’s also important to store your vape properly. Keep it in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ight. If you’re traveling with your vape, make sure to turn it off and remove the batteries to prevent accidental activation.

Common Misconceptions About Vapes

Ah, vapes. They’re a relatively new technology, and with that comes a lot of misconceptions. Here are some common ones:

Myth #1: Vaping is just as bad as smoking.

This is simply not true. While vaping is not risk-free, it is substantially less harmful than smoking. In fact, a 2022 UK review of international evidence found that “in the short and medium-term, vaping poses a small fraction of the risks of smoking” (NHS).

Myth #2: You can’t get addicted to vaping.

Oh, you can. Most e-cigarettes contain nicotine, which is an addictive substance. In fact, vaping can be even more addictive than smoking, because the nicotine is often delivered in higher doses (SEARHC).

Myth #3: Vaping is odorless.

Sorry, but no. While vaping doesn’t produce the same stinky smoke as cigarettes, it still has a smell. And it’s not always a pleasant one. Plus, some e-liquids have added flavors that can be overpowering (Penn Medicine).

Myth #4: You can’t vape without e-liquid.

Actually, you can. But it’s not a good idea. Vaping without e-liquid can damage your device and even cause it to explode (HealthyU).

Myth #5: You can vape water.

Please don’t. It’s a terrible idea. Water doesn’t vaporize at the same temperature as e-liquid, so if you try to vape it, you’ll just end up with boiling water in your mouth. Ouch. Plus, inhaling steam can cause serious damage to your lungs (HealthyU).
